Tasting Notes
What a joy, tasting an elegant Durif after many years - I can’t remember ever putting the thought of Elegant and Durif together! Powerful dusty savoury black fruits, lifted spice notes; with such smooth, fine chalky tannins. Restrained 13.6% alc from Rutherglen nice to find. Unctuous! - Michael L
Durif with 85% of the stems included during fermentation. Striking, savoury, intense, structured. Inspired by the Rhone Valley in France, the use of stems delivers fragrance and fine, long tannin. Expect a wine of certain intensity, but also elegance, and the most pure, savoury red and dark fruit. Wild yeast fermentation, maturation in Foudre (no new oak). Unfiltered. - Winery Note
